AppDomainSetup.AppDomainManagerAssembly 屬性
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
取得或設定組件的顯示名稱,這個組件可為使用這個 AppDomainSetup 物件建立的應用程式定義域,提供應用程式定義域管理員類型。
public:
property System::String ^ AppDomainManagerAssembly { System::String ^ get(); void set(System::String ^ value); };
public string AppDomainManagerAssembly { get; set; }
member this.AppDomainManagerAssembly : string with get, set
Public Property AppDomainManagerAssembly As String
屬性值
組件的顯示名稱,這個組件可提供應用程式定義域管理員的 Type。
備註
若要指定應用程式域管理員的類型,請同時設定此屬性和 AppDomainManagerType 屬性。 如果未設定其中一個屬性,則會忽略另一個屬性。
如果未提供任何類型,則會從與父應用程式域相同的類型建立應用程式域管理員 (,也就是從 AppDomain.CreateDomain 中呼叫 方法的應用程式域) 。
載入應用程式域時, TypeLoadException 如果元件不存在,或元件不包含 屬性所 AppDomainManagerType 指定的類型,則會擲回 。 FileLoadException 如果找到元件,但版本資訊不符,則會擲回 。
若要設定預設應用程式域的應用程式域管理員,請使用應用程式組態檔運行 <> 時間區段中的appDomainManagerAssembly > 和 appDomainManagerType 元素,或使用 中所述的環境變數。 <><AppDomainManager
這項功能需要應用程式具有完全信任。 (例如,在桌面上執行的應用程式具有完全信任。) 如果應用程式沒有完全信任, TypeLoadException 則會擲回 。
元件顯示名稱的格式是由 Assembly.FullName 屬性提供。